Practical Cheat‑Sheet for the Cynic

  • Set a hard cap on session loss before you even log in; the temptation to chase a near‑miss is a well‑known trap.
  • Choose games with RTP above 96% – Starburst sits at 96.1%, Gonzo’s Quest edges higher, but remember the variance can still devour your balance.
  • Avoid “bonus round” promises that sound like free meals – they’re just extra reels designed to mask the same odds.
  • Prefer straight‑line slots over multi‑feature beasts if you dislike watching your bankroll evaporate mid‑spin.
  • Check the time‑zone of withdrawal processing; a sluggish system can ruin the whole weekend.

Marketing Gimmicks That Won’t Save Your Bankroll

Every new sign‑up bonus at 888casino feels like a warm‑up act before the real show – a barrage of “free” chips that disappear faster than a cheap lollipop at the dentist. The terms are usually padded with tiny print that forces you to wager 30× the bonus before you can touch a penny. It’s not generosity, it’s arithmetic disguised as kindness.

Even the “VIP lounge” promises are nothing more than a glossy veneer. You get a slick interface and a personal account manager who politely reminds you that the house always wins. The only thing VIP about it is the price you pay in time and hidden fees.

Because the industry loves to spin the same yarn, you’ll see the same three tactics recycled: deposit matches, risk‑free bets, and a handful of free spins that expire before you can even plan a proper session. Strategic Adjustments That Actually Work

Because the industry’s fluff is relentless, you need a set of hardened tactics. First, track your wins and losses meticulously – a spreadsheet beats any “player’s lounge” dashboard. Second, rotate games based on volatility profiles; don’t stick to one high‑risk title all night. Third, set win targets and stick to them. If you hit a 20% profit, cash out. The temptation to push for a bigger win is a classic pitfall that swallows most casual players.
